What Is The Toilet Flush Handle Called. The toilet flush handle is commonly referred to as the flush lever. The toilet flush handle is simple the small tank lever that you push whenever you want to flush the toilet. When you press down on the handle to flush the toilet, it lifts a lever inside the tank connected to a chain and circular rubber flapper. The bowl is refilled by the fill tube as water flows down the overflow valve and into the bowl. The flush handle, also known as the flush lever, is the primary mechanism by which water is released from the toilet’s tank to flush.
